WAPNER, J. pro tem.*

Policemen who were called by firemen to the scene of a fire in a residential unit of an apartment building seized, among other things, a quantity of dynamite, numerous machine gun parts (later assembled into four machine guns), an automatic pistol equipped with a silencer, and a document described as an "application for rental."
